Organisation Overview
Pharo Foundation (“the Foundation”) is a mission-driven, impact-oriented organisation that designs, funds, and operates economic development programmes towards a vibrant, productive, and self-reliant Africa. Over the next decade, our goal is to create maximum impact towards three critical missions:
Pharo Foundation’s education mission is implemented through the Pharo-brand schools, ranging from kindergarten, to primary and secondary. The Foundation operates four Pharo schools in Somaliland, Vocational Training Centre, Pharo Kindergarten, Pharo Primary, and Pharo Secondary Boarding school in Sheikh district.
The Foundation also operates Pharo Ventures which is the for-profit arm of its operations with sustainable businesses in Ethiopia and Somaliland geared towards job creation and economic empowerment.
With over 700 employees in Ethiopia, Kenya, Rwanda, and Somaliland, we are a diverse, multicultural, and passionate organisation. We have our headquarters in Nairobi, Kenya, and a liaison office in London, UK, which is home to our parent organisation, Pharo Management.

Position Summary
Position: School Librarian
Reporting to: Lower Primary Headteacher
Location: Hargeisa, Somaliland
Contract type: Fixed Term
We are currently looking for an enthusiastic School Librarian to work full-time at our prestigious Primary school. The Librarian will ensure that the library is strategically managed and continuously developed as well as open and available to students. He/she will supervise and manage the school library/media centre and provide services and resources that allow students to develop skills in locating, evaluating and using information to solve problems.
